Is there somebody there , who's PRO in modding; that could help me with this ? Because this is what I exactly did..

1) Open up base model extract all textures and convert them via puyotools
2) Edit some parts via Photoshop then saved them
3) Re-converted all .PNG's to .GIM with Gim Conv.exe
4) Created a Texture archive with all .GIM's and saved them to "09a.pac"
5) Injected the original 09.pac of the Base Model to my "09a.pac" and closed X-packer
6) Imported the final .PAC file
7) Saved it via an ISO
8) Paste the ISO to my PSP / Memory Stick
9) No changes.. Why ? :(

my same mistake i did months ago :) ...if you don't find your changes in the game it's sure that you have put again bpe file..you must inject as said HARDX36 the pac file..

after you have done your texture archive in pac you have to inject where stands his bpe file..
exemple: if bpe file is called C8.bpe you have to call your archive C8.pac and inject him in main file where stands C8.bpe.
if your textures are modded with attemption without more bites than bpe you will have no problems
if C8.bpe is 7002 bites
your C8.pc must be 7002 !..
if is bigger game will crash.
when i mod textures i work to have a pac file a little less than bpe and then i put missing bites with a hex editor.
C8.bpe =7002
if my C8.pac is 6690 i do
7002-6690=312
i put 312 bites with hex editor and i have the same file as bpe.
